586 Households Near Sinpung Station... 19-Story Office Building in Euljiro 3-ga

Seoul City Approves 2 Cases at Integrated Review Committee for Maintenance Projects

A 35-story building with 586 households will be constructed near Sinpung Station on Seoul Subway Line 7. Next to Nogari Alley in Euljiro 3-ga, Jung-gu, a 19-story office building will be developed.

On the 11th, Seoul City held the 6th Integrated Review Committee for Redevelopment Projects and announced on the 13th that it had approved two review proposals with these details.


The site for the apartment complex is the Singil 13 District in Yeongdeungpo-gu, where a public reconstruction project will build six buildings ranging from five basement floors to 35 above-ground floors, totaling 586 households. Among these, 186 units will be public housing. This is the first time a public reconstruction project promoted by Seoul Housing and Communities Corporation (SH Corporation) has undergone the integrated review committee. The city conducted a comprehensive review covering architecture, landscape, transportation, and education sectors.


According to the project plan, a public pedestrian passageway will be created on the site, considering the southern Singil Neighborhood Park and the flow to Sinpung Station. Resident community facilities will be concentrated around this area. The northern part of the site will be arranged with mid-rise or lower buildings to respect the surrounding residential complexes, while the southern part will have high-rise buildings considering the adjacent park.

The 9 District near Euljiro 3-ga Station was originally planned as an urban maintenance-type redevelopment project for residential and lodging facilities, but the use has been changed to a single 19-story office building. An open green space connected to the entrance of Euljiro 3-ga Station will be arranged, and green resting areas will be provided by linking publicly accessible spaces within the complex and low-rise neighborhood living facilities. A landscaped rooftop space will be created with an elevator installed for direct access from the first floor, making it open to the public.


Han Byung-yong, Director of the Housing Office at Seoul City, said, "We expect an increase in new housing supply within station areas and expanded provision of public spaces and green resting areas." He added, "We will continue to rapidly supply quality housing and promptly secure insufficient green spaces through integrated reviews in urban redevelopment projects."
